Obsessive compulsive disorder(OCD)

  • Obsessive compulsive disorder (OCD) is a mental health condition. It causes a person to have obsessive thoughts and carry out compulsive activity.
  • This can be distressing and have a big impact on your life. Treatment can help you keep it under control.

Symptoms of OCD

  • OCD affects people differently. It usually causes a particular pattern of thought and behaviour.
  • This pattern has 4 main steps:
  • Obsession – where an intrusive, distressing thought, image or urge repeatedly enters your mind.
  • Anxiety – the obsession provokes a feeling of intense anxiety or distress.
  • Compulsion – repetitive behaviours or mental acts that you feel you have to do as a result of the anxiety and distress caused by the obsession.
  • Temporary relief – the compulsive behaviour brings temporary relief, but the obsession and anxiety return, causing the cycle to begin again.
